Discover Kaneohe, HI

Kaneohe, a picturesque town on the windward coast of Oahu, Hawaii, is renowned for its lush landscapes, vibrant culture, and welcoming community. Nestled between the majestic Ko'olau mountain range and the sparkling waters of Kaneohe Bay, this charming town offers a unique blend of natural beauty and local charm that captivates both residents and visitors alike.

Parks and Outdoors

Nature lovers will find Kaneohe to be a paradise. The area is rich in parks and outdoor spaces, including the stunning Kaneohe Bay, where residents can enjoy kayaking, paddleboarding, and snorkeling. The nearby Ho'omaluhia Botanical Garden offers a tranquil escape with its lush landscapes and walking trails, while the Ko'olau mountains provide ample hiking opportunities for adventure seekers. Families can enjoy picnicking and recreational activities at local parks such as Kaneohe District Park, which features playgrounds, sports facilities, and open spaces for community gatherings.
